Chapter Plan and Summary

This is one of the most useful tools which I have used in recent months and honestly, I wish I'd started using it sooner. Creating a chapter by chapter plan helps to create an overarching plan of the whole novel.

How Do I create a Chapter Plan?

You can create a simple chapter plan with two columns. One with the chapter number or name, the other column, a summary of what occurs in the chapter. The chapter plan doesn't have to be perfect and no reader will ever see it.

What else can I do with a Chapter Plan?

If you can't persuade your friends, partners or loved ones to read your work, briefly talking through some of your chapter plan with them may help you to pin point what could be of interest to a reader, expand on ideas, and come up with new ones. You may also develop a feeling for what can be trimmed or edited out.

What Questions Should I Be Asking with A Chapter Plan?

For each chapter, you should be asking, does it create tension, explore a theme or character? If one or more of these answers is no, you may wish to reuse the best parts of a particular chapter to enhance one of the chapters that do work. If you've repeated the message of a prior chapter and a chapter adds nothing to the story, you may wish to cut it out all together.

If you're not sure if a chapter works, you may wish to examine the chapter with a very basic question: Does anything even occur in the chapter and has this been added to the chapter plan?

You can also use the chapter plan as a more general tool to help you out of any difficulties or ruts. What is missing and what direction do you feel it needs to go?
